Compatibility with N5 and N4 Pro
The first thing I check is whether the mount is truly compatible with both the N5 and N4 Pro. I look at the size, shape, and attachment style of the GPS unit. If the mount is not designed for these models, I risk a loose fit or poor support. I always prefer a product that clearly mentions compatibility with both devices.
Strong Suction and Secure Grip
In my experience, the suction cup is the most important part. I want a mount that sticks well to the windshield or dashboard and does not slip during hot weather or bumpy rides. A strong suction base gives me confidence that my GPS will stay put. If the suction feels weak, I usually skip that option.
Adjustability and Viewing Angle
I always check whether the mount offers flexible adjustment. A good suction cup GPS mount should let me tilt, rotate, and reposition the device easily. I prefer being able to set the screen at eye level without blocking my view of the road. This makes navigation much easier for me while driving.
Build Quality and Durability
I look for sturdy materials like reinforced plastic or metal joints because I want the mount to last. Cheap mounts often wear out quickly, especially if I move them often or leave them exposed to heat. A durable mount saves me money in the long run and gives me better peace of mind.
Ease of Installation and Removal
I like mounts that are simple to install without tools. A quick-lock suction system is ideal for me because I can attach or remove it in seconds. If I need to move the GPS between vehicles, I want the process to be smooth and hassle-free.
Dashboard and Windshield Compatibility
I make sure the mount works well on the surface I plan to use. Some suction cups perform better on smooth windshields, while others may need a dashboard pad for better grip. I usually choose a mount that offers versatile placement options so I can use it in different cars.
Vibration Resistance
When I drive on rough roads, vibration can make the GPS screen shake or become hard to read. That is why I pay attention to how well the mount absorbs movement. A stable mount helps me keep the display clear and reduces the chance of the device falling.
